Add emoji list

https://www.phpbb.com/ideas/
Post Reply
User avatar
sysz
Registered User
Posts: 278
Joined: Mon Jan 30, 2012 11:36 pm
Location: Sweden, Helsingborg
Name: Kimmy Lindell Ekström
Contact:

Add emoji list

Post by sysz » Mon Sep 11, 2017 3:03 pm

Since phpBB 3.2 now support emoji i think there also should be an option to show an emoji list instead of smilies list in the post reply page. It make sense since emoji is pretty much used by most modern people today.
Currently working on the community

User avatar
david63
Registered User
Posts: 16718
Joined: Thu Dec 19, 2002 8:08 am
Location: Lancashire, UK
Name: David Wood
Contact:

Re: Add emoji list

Post by david63 » Mon Sep 11, 2017 3:13 pm

I believe that the main problem with doing that is that the Emoji libraries are not very well maintained and are liable to disappear at any moment.
David
Remember: You only know what you know and - you don't know what you don't know!
My CDB Contributions | How to install an extension
I will not be accepting translations for any of my extensions in Github - please post any translations in the appropriate topic.
No support requests via PM or email as they will be ignored

User avatar
JimA
Community Team Leader
Community Team Leader
Posts: 7663
Joined: Thu Jul 31, 2008 5:54 am
Location: The Netherlands
Name: Jim Mossing Holsteyn
Contact:

Re: Add emoji list

Post by JimA » Mon Sep 11, 2017 4:15 pm

I actually quite like that idea, as long as it's a link that wouldn't bloat up the posting editor itself too much. Maybe under the "More smilies" link, add something like "Emoji list".
Image Jim Mossing Holsteyn - Community Team Leader
Knowledge Base | Documentation | Board rules

If you're having any questions about the rules/customs of this website, feel free to drop me a PM.

User avatar
Mannix_
Registered User
Posts: 570
Joined: Sun Oct 25, 2015 2:56 pm
Contact:

Re: Add emoji list

Post by Mannix_ » Sun Sep 17, 2017 2:48 pm

JimA wrote:
Mon Sep 11, 2017 4:15 pm
I actually quite like that idea, as long as it's a link that wouldn't bloat up the posting editor itself too much. Maybe under the "More smilies" link, add something like "Emoji list".
You could do a scrollable list if there would be to much of them. I think there is already an extension for that for the smilies.
-=-=-=-=-=-=-=-=-=-=-=-=-My Styles-=-=-=-=-=-=-=-=-=-=-=-=-
HexagonHexagonRebornCleanSilverProject Durango
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-
Want me to port a style to 3.2.x etc. contact me here or on twitter.

User avatar
Leinad4Mind
Translator
Posts: 852
Joined: Sun Jun 01, 2008 11:08 pm
Contact:

Re: Add emoji list

Post by Leinad4Mind » Thu Oct 05, 2017 1:29 am

That's why I've created some "smilies" pack with emojis .svg images. And it's working perfectly on 3.2.

But yeah, a picker would be nice to have if people want to keep smilies too.
And a ticket was already created for that: https://tracker.phpbb.com/browse/PHPBB3-14963

Cheers
Want to access all my portuguese MOD and Extension translations?
Become my Patreon!
phpBB Portugal Translator and Moderator

Selective
Registered User
Posts: 213
Joined: Sat Apr 19, 2014 10:30 am

Re: Add emoji list

Post by Selective » Wed Jan 10, 2018 7:58 pm

I'm creating a bunch of custom emojis and when I started uploading them, I noticed a huge problem! They are not contained in a scrollable window and they are not in a popup window either!

I remember many years ago, there was a guy that created a website where people posting on his forum, would have a single Smilies button that would popup a rectangle window of scrollable emojis. Then you would just scroll them in that popup window, and click on one, and it would put the code into the edit (topic/post page) for you.

Can we have something like that?

The guy that had built that was the guy that created, owned, and ran "FindAGoth" and that was his website that he had the script on! FindAGoth doesn't exist anymore! It's gone!

We need someone like that guy, in charge of the smilies script.

User avatar
3Di
Former Team Member
Posts: 14389
Joined: Mon Apr 04, 2005 11:09 pm
Location: Milan (IT) Frankfurt (DE)
Name: Marco
Contact:

Re: Add emoji list

Post by 3Di » Thu Jan 11, 2018 12:04 am

I voted yes, that's why:
https://tracker.phpbb.com/browse/PHPBB3-14963

That's a must have IMHO.
Please PM me only to request paid works. Thx.
Want to compensate me for my interest? Donate
My development's activity º PhpStorm's proud user
Extensions, Scripts, MOD porting, Update/Upgrades
✒️ Black Friday 2019 @ The Studio ▪️◾️

User avatar
Mick
Support Team Member
Support Team Member
Posts: 21681
Joined: Fri Aug 29, 2008 9:49 am
Location: Cardiff

Re: Add emoji list

Post by Mick » Thu Jan 11, 2018 9:41 am

More bloat in my opinion.
"The more connected we get the more alone we become" - Kyle Broflovski

User avatar
warmweer
Registered User
Posts: 3055
Joined: Fri Jul 04, 2003 6:34 am
Location: Van Allen Belt ... well actually Belgium

Re: Add emoji list

Post by warmweer » Thu Jan 11, 2018 12:17 pm

3Di wrote:
Thu Jan 11, 2018 12:04 am
I voted yes, that's why:
https://tracker.phpbb.com/browse/PHPBB3-14963

That's a must have IMHO.
Then please include a switch, button whatever to allow complete blocking of that feature. I fully agree with smilies and wouldn't want to lose that, but emoji's are going a bit too far from: nowadays people can't talk anymore, let alone show a sincere expression unless (or perhaps I should state: not even with) emojicoticon(itwits).
The year is 2192. The British Prime Minister visits Brussels to ask for an extension of the Brexit deadline. No one remembers where this tradition originated, but every year it attracts many tourists from all over the world.

Selective
Registered User
Posts: 213
Joined: Sat Apr 19, 2014 10:30 am

Re: Add emoji list

Post by Selective » Fri Jan 12, 2018 10:05 am

Smileys/Emojis/Emoticons, whatever you want to call them... the ones that came with phpBB are stupid and ugly, and most on the internet are too large and stupid.

I'm creating a set of really cool HD ones with transparent backgrounds, all at the size of 42x42, and I'm simplifying them to only the most basic and needed of expressions.

Once they are done, I could see about making a download for the set, here on phpBB.

For the moment, I rewrote the posting page script, so that it has a scrollable box to the right with a vertical scroll, and they are shown in rows of 10, for all of the Smileys/Emojis/Emoticons.
Last edited by Selective on Fri Jan 12, 2018 10:14 am, edited 1 time in total.

User avatar
RMcGirr83
Recognised Extension Developer
Posts: 21034
Joined: Wed Jun 22, 2005 4:33 pm
Location: Your display
Name: Rich McGirr
Contact:

Re: Add emoji list

Post by RMcGirr83 » Fri Jan 12, 2018 10:08 am

Selective wrote:
Fri Jan 12, 2018 10:05 am
the ones that came with phpBB are stupid and ugly, and most on the internet are too large and stupid.
Emojis can be intelligent?

PS the "emojis" that "come with phpBB" are from emojione IIRC. 😉
In times of change, learners inherit the earth, while the learned find themselves beautifully equipped to deal with a world that no longer exists - Eric Hoffer
Former Modifications/Extensions Team Member | My extensions
Appreciate the extensions/mods/support then buy me a beer
All requests for support via PM will be ignored

User avatar
AmigoJack
Registered User
Posts: 5642
Joined: Tue Jun 15, 2010 11:33 am
Location: グリーン ヒル ゾーン
Contact:

Re: Add emoji list

Post by AmigoJack » Fri Jan 26, 2018 9:05 am

In my board I optimized the editor layout and filled the free space with a list of symbols (not only emojis), which appears just under the smileys and is also scrollable:
20180126 emojis.png
Best part is: I'm not using any libraries to re-interpret the symbols by pictures - they're displayed just like the chosen font supports it. The code is as simple as this (shortened):

Code: Select all

	$aEmoji= array
	( 0x2605=> 'Black star'
	, 0x1F427=> 'Penguin'
	, 0x1F4A9=> 'Pile of poo'
	, 0x1F606=> 'Smiling face with open mouth and tightly-closed eyes'
	);

	foreach( $aEmoji as $iEmoji=> $sEmoji )
	$template-> assign_block_vars
	( 'emoji', array
		( 'CODE'=> '&#'. $iEmoji. ';'
		, 'TITLE'=> $sEmoji
		)
	);
The worst thing about censorship is ███████████
Affin wrote:
Tue Nov 20, 2018 9:51 am
The problem is probably not my English but you do not want to understand correctly.
...
We will not come anybody anyway, nevertheless, it's best to shit this.

User avatar
Mannix_
Registered User
Posts: 570
Joined: Sun Oct 25, 2015 2:56 pm
Contact:

Re: Add emoji list

Post by Mannix_ » Fri Jan 26, 2018 9:32 am

AmigoJack wrote:
Fri Jan 26, 2018 9:05 am
In my board I optimized the editor layout and filled the free space with a list of symbols (not only emojis), which appears just under the smileys and is also scrollable:
20180126 emojis.png
Best part is: I'm not using any libraries to re-interpret the symbols by pictures - they're displayed just like the chosen font supports it. The code is as simple as this (shortened):

Code: Select all

	$aEmoji= array
	( 0x2605=> 'Black star'
	, 0x1F427=> 'Penguin'
	, 0x1F4A9=> 'Pile of poo'
	, 0x1F606=> 'Smiling face with open mouth and tightly-closed eyes'
	);

	foreach( $aEmoji as $iEmoji=> $sEmoji )
	$template-> assign_block_vars
	( 'emoji', array
		( 'CODE'=> '&#'. $iEmoji. ';'
		, 'TITLE'=> $sEmoji
		)
	);
This looks dope thanks for that :)
-=-=-=-=-=-=-=-=-=-=-=-=-My Styles-=-=-=-=-=-=-=-=-=-=-=-=-
HexagonHexagonRebornCleanSilverProject Durango
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-
Want me to port a style to 3.2.x etc. contact me here or on twitter.

Selective
Registered User
Posts: 213
Joined: Sat Apr 19, 2014 10:30 am

Re: Add emoji list

Post by Selective » Sat Jan 27, 2018 4:08 am

@AmigoJack

Very cool, thanks for sharing that.


For those waiting for my custom Emojis, I'm actually building a new forum from the ground up, and the new custom emojis are last on the priority list. So it could be a few more months before I can get back to them. I will finish them eventually though, once I get some other stuff out of the way first.

User avatar
Hanakin
Front-End Dev Team Lead
Front-End Dev Team Lead
Posts: 913
Joined: Wed Dec 30, 2009 8:14 am
Name: Michael Miday
Contact:

Re: Add emoji list

Post by Hanakin » Mon Mar 11, 2019 7:27 pm

the new theme will have an emoji picker that integrates custom emojis i.e. smiles. I am already working on it

viewtopic.php?p=15215646#p15215646

Post Reply

Return to “phpBB Ideas”